Multiplicity of viewpoints refers to the recognition and acceptance of various perspectives and interpretations of truth and reality. In Jain philosophy, this concept emphasizes that no single viewpoint can capture the entirety of an object or experience, and thus understanding arises from considering multiple angles. This approach fosters a more comprehensive understanding and promotes dialogue among differing beliefs and ideas.
